Output e05be1524967379d1e6662eaf4c72ab1668cbc8900ee0965a78a0cb9f4daf163:2

value
3359542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 270ab5d3b371d8881e047600ed19dcb12e3eb436 OP_EQUALVERIFY OP_CHECKSIG
address
14ZSBeKR27n8GzHBbqyja8iojAPQDfNng7
transaction
e05be1524967379d1e6662eaf4c72ab1668cbc8900ee0965a78a0cb9f4daf163
confirmations
627578
spent
true